Lets discuss this in slightly more detail than "YES NO NO MAYBE" shall we?

1. Medics: Unlikely. Reviving or magically healing players is not realistic and players are already able to bandage themselves, so there's not much need for them there either. With all those options out, it doesn't leave much for a medic class to do other than fight like a regular soldier, which begs the question - why have medics?

2. Close Air Support: Not in the initial release of HoS. Later on? Who knows. I don't doubt that it's an idea that has been considered. I even thought about it for DH for a while. There are many difficulties to consider though, so I wouldn't hold my breath.

3. Kicking doors down: This assumes that there will be doors. RO had them, but they were crude and stopped seeing any use after the first few maps. I doubt that there will be a need for this as a feature.

4. Throwing grenades into tanks: Highly unlikely. Apart from the extra animations and programming required, this is not something that happened often in reality. Just getting that close to an enemy tank wasn't common and I believe tank crews started locking hatches after a while to prevent just this sort of thing from happening.

5. Sticky Bombs: These won't be needed. HoS will have plenty of anti-vehicle weapons and RS will have even more. The niche that these might fill will already be covered by other more effective weapons.

6. A Moscow map: There's a very good chance of seeing one in later updates. Whether it's an official TW map or a custom map that's added in as official content I couldn't say, but hey, ROOST got Leningrad where there wasn't even any fighting, so I'd say it's likely.

7. Mines: Might see these, might not. Mines have the problem though of filling up servers and every time you respawn, hey more mines! Before long, maps would be unplayable because some twat thinks it's funny to carpet-mine a spawn exit or something like that. I'm leaning towards this as being something that won't happen.

8. Tripwire grenades: Won't happen. Although it sounds like a simple thing, it's not quite that easy from a technical perspective to create. I also can't imagine that it was a common tactic in Stalingrad, so there's not enough basis to justify its addition.

9. A Melee system: In one of TW's recent interviews they mentioned that they were hoping to have a more complex melee system. Whether they have the time to bring that to fruition is another matter.

10. Dynamic player-placed defences: This won't happen. It's too difficult to add and too easy to abuse. Magically spawning defence structures is also quite gamey and would upset most of the community in these parts.
